Africa’s top builders, investors, and entrepreneurs under Code Africa converged in Nairobi for the first-ever Africa Emerging Tech Awards, honouring the most impactful startups, founders, and projects advancing Africa’s innovation economy. This year’s expanded programming introduced the Demo Day Pitching Side Event, offering startup founders the opportunity to pitch live to leading VCs, angel investors and accelerators. Solutions across decentralised finance, AI infrastructure, and next-generation technologies... Aspiring tech professionals also secured mentorship, portfolio-building activities, and career opportunities in Africa’s fastest-growing industries.
